Wiktionary
GIVEAWAY, noun. Something that is given away or handed out for free.
GIVEAWAY, noun. An event at which things are given away for free.
GIVEAWAY, noun. Something that is obvious or apparent; something that reveals a secret.
Dictionary definition
GIVEAWAY, noun. A gift of public land or resources for the private gain of a limited group.
GIVEAWAY, noun. An unintentional disclosure.
GIVEAWAY, noun. A television or radio program in which contestants compete for awards.
